]> git.baikalelectronics.ru Git - kernel.git/commit
xsk: support BPF_EXIST and BPF_NOEXIST flags in XSKMAP
authorBjörn Töpel <bjorn.topel@intel.com>
Thu, 15 Aug 2019 09:30:14 +0000 (11:30 +0200)
committerDaniel Borkmann <daniel@iogearbox.net>
Sat, 17 Aug 2019 21:24:45 +0000 (23:24 +0200)
commit571f8b958ed05f253db484478bf944634f3d17ef
treed620399395987e1a16c5972eb97c8b2fd7725623
parentc5c1cc6028d360e371f25a5977aef83c463879e4
xsk: support BPF_EXIST and BPF_NOEXIST flags in XSKMAP

The XSKMAP did not honor the BPF_EXIST/BPF_NOEXIST flags when updating
an entry. This patch addresses that.

Signed-off-by: Björn Töpel <bjorn.topel@intel.com>
Signed-off-by: Daniel Borkmann <daniel@iogearbox.net>
kernel/bpf/xskmap.c